Steel Kit Homes And Sustainability

When it comes time to build your dream home, you want to know that the materials you select will be strong, resilient and will last you for many years to come. You want style, affordability and a house built to suit your needs and the ever-changing environment.

Sustainability is a very prominent consideration in the construction industry today. The needs of current generations must be considered without encumbering the capability of future generations to meet their own needs Kit Home.

Minimal environmental impact from our activities now can assist future generations, by way of:

>> Energy efficiency

>> Water quality and conservation

>> Degradation of land

... >> Waste generation


>> Depletion of resources

>> Biological diversity conservation and

>> Human and ecological health

You may wonder what that has to do with building materials?

By using durable materials such as steel, we can conserve precious resources and the reduction in energy consumption, means that the manufacturing processes of other products with less durability are significantly reduced.

In addition, the fact that steel unlike wood, does not rot, warp, twist or split means that many steel products can simply be recycled, without the need for reprocessing. This again, puts considerably less stress on our energy and resources.

When it comes to construction materials, sustainability can be achieved with the implementation of certain materials like steel, as mentioned for the above reasons. Additionally steel is 100% recyclable with an immeasurable lifespan, making it hard for other less durable and sustainable building materials to compete with.

BlueScope steel, an Australian company of over 40 years, supply quality steel and can be used in building designs considered 'greener' due to the improvement of thermal comfort and better energy efficiency. This assists builders in meeting compulsory requirements when it comes to sustainability.

BlueScope steel manufactures Colorbond steel with Thermatech® solar reflectance technology. It helps to reduce the sun's heat making homes and workplaces more comfortable and assists with energy efficiency, thus reducing cooling expenses. This reason alone can be enough to choose steel as your preferred material to build your home.

A steel framed home will not retain additional heat after the sun has set, and cools down more rapidly than other building materials such as a brick home, making it more comfortable in the summer months and a preferable material to use in tropical areas. Being termite and fire resistant are more positive characteristics of Steel Kit Home.

Steel frames and steel flooring systems are a method to combat sloping areas of land, which are increasing due to the shortage of flat land availability. By using a steel frame you avoid having to cut and fill the area, saving expensive building costs.

This assists in the prevention of erosion and enables the natural contour of the land to be incorporated with the design of the house. Ventilation beneath the home means airflow can keep the heat at a minimum in warmer phases of the year.
